Output 7843f66bb4f1fdc303a629b201934d4dffc3b6767c0656075ae33ce02d74eb71:1

value
8553263
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af2b5b7003c0d8fc512058c67e9f09aea8454825 OP_EQUAL
address
3HfE7d86MNdFKYmXMABY9J9u21Rxmp3YXj
transaction
7843f66bb4f1fdc303a629b201934d4dffc3b6767c0656075ae33ce02d74eb71
spent
true